The Kootenay Wage Subsidy Program (KWS) helps in two ways:

  • For employers, the reimbursement offsets costs incurred during the training period for a new employee.
  • KWS also assists individuals who are the perfect fit but could benefit from on-the-job experience.

The Kootenay Wage Subsidy Program helps offset the cost of hiring a new employee by covering up to 60% of wage costs while a new worker is being trained. The Kootenay Wage Subsidy Program can also be tailored to help an employer accommodate a worker with a disability.

This program is funded by Employment and Labour Market Services (Government of BC).   Eligible individuals who would benefit from on-the-job work experience must either be on a current EI Regular benefits claim or have been on EI in the past 3 years (or 5 years for maternity or parental benefits).

Kootenay Wage Subsidy program provides services to: Nelson, South Slocan, Slocan City, Kaslo, Crawford Bay, Boswell, Ainsworth, Balfour, and Ymir, Salmo.

Employers will benefit by:

  1. Reduce the hiring & training cost of a new employee.  
  2. Wages reimbursed up to 60% for up to a 6 month period
  3. Minimal paperwork – we do the work!
  4. Wages reimbursed every 2 weeks
  5. Free job postings on our website and job board
  6. On-going support for the duration of the contract

Employers qualify for KWS if they:

  • Commit to providing ongoing, full-time employment for a new employee
  • Pay employees a salary or hourly wage and make required payroll deductions
  • Normally, have been in business for one year
  • Negotiate the agreement with the KWS Coordinator prior to hiring
  • Are a private, public, or non-profit organization
